Transaction 4378db5da10401e893158abdffee9f912b183f48333ecefee81f7a9749442022
2 Input
2 Outputs
- 4378db5da10401e893158abdffee9f912b183f48333ecefee81f7a9749442022:0
- 4378db5da10401e893158abdffee9f912b183f48333ecefee81f7a9749442022:1
value 616
address 15ViwzDPvg4GkuchHQRPqT7Gw2NUbdgP3x
value 954506
address 1Hx3WZ9Gz5wYBFdsTWbDqu2gxVqdP6yFSu